Key Responsibilities

  • Create, maintain, renew, and administer service and maintenance contracts
  • Ensure planned preventative maintenance (PPM) visits are scheduled and completed in line with contractual requirements
  • Schedule engineers and third-party contractors for reactive and planned maintenance works
  • Allocate resources effectively based on engineer skill sets, location, availability, and customer requirements
  • Manage engineer diaries to maximise utilisation and operational efficiency
  • Coordinate the dispatch and delivery of materials, tools, and equipment required for service visits
  • Monitor the progress of reactive and planned maintenance jobs, taking ownership of outstanding actions through to completion
  • Keep customers regularly updated regarding job progress, engineer attendance, and any delays
  • Process estimate acceptances and raise purchase orders where required
  • Ensure all completed jobs are accurately closed and prepared for invoicing within agreed timescales
  • Update customer asset records, service documentation, and internal systems to ensure data accuracy
  • Chase outstanding job sheets and documentation from engineers and subcontractors
  • Produce reports relating to outstanding jobs, contracts, engineer utilisation, and service performance
  • Monitor parts deliveries and arrange return visits where necessary
  • Maintain customer portals and ensure all information is current and accurate
  • Produce engineer timesheet reports and support payroll administration processes
  • Liaise with customers, engineers, subcontractors, warehouse teams, and internal stakeholders to ensure seamless service delivery
  • Respond promptly to customer enquiries, resolving issues professionally and escalating where appropriate
  • Support contract retention by delivering excellent customer service and building strong client relationships
  • Assist with continuous improvement initiatives and identify opportunities to improve efficiency and profitability
  • Provide support across the wider Service & Maintenance department when required
